magento数据转移-换服务器后转移数据

来源:互联网 发布:office 2013 mac 编辑:程序博客网 时间:2024/04/30 22:37

1.进入原来的phymyadmin,选择magento的那个数据库,在右边的标签上点击导出。

2.全选所有的表,结构那儿都勾上:添加 DROP TABLE,如果不存在就增加,添加 AUTO_INCREMENT 值,请在表名及字段名使用引号;数据那儿选择完整插入;勾上另存为文件,点击执行,保存当前数据库 。

3.打开保存的数据库导出的文件

在头上添加

SET @OLD_CHARACTER_SET_CLIENT=@@CHARACTER_SET_CLIENT; SET @OLD_CHARACTER_SET_RESULTS=@@CHARACTER_SET_RESULTS; SET @OLD_COLLATION_CONNECTION=@@COLLATION_CONNECTION; SET NAMES utf8; SET @OLD_UNIQUE_CHECKS=@@UNIQUE_CHECKS, UNIQUE_CHECKS=0; SET @OLD_FOREIGN_KEY_CHECKS=@@FOREIGN_KEY_CHECKS, FOREIGN_KEY_CHECKS=0; SET @OLD_SQL_MODE=@@SQL_MODE, SQL_MODE=’NO_AUTO_VALUE_ON_ZERO’; SET @OLD_SQL_NOTES=@@SQL_NOTES, SQL_NOTES=0;

在结尾添加
SET SQL_MODE=@OLD_SQL_MODE; SET FOREIGN_KEY_CHECKS=@OLD_FOREIGN_KEY_CHECKS; SET UNIQUE_CHECKS=@OLD_UNIQUE_CHECKS; SET CHARACTER_SET_CLIENT=@OLD_CHARACTER_SET_CLIENT; SET CHARACTER_SET_RESULTS=@OLD_CHARACTER_SET_RESULTS; SET COLLATION_CONNECTION=@OLD_COLLATION_CONNECTION; SET SQL_NOTES=@OLD_SQL_NOTES;

然后查找并且替换所有的 原来的主路径 到 现在的主路径(比如原来是www.bmagento.com,现在是www.100magento.com,必须要全部替换掉),不然数据转移后的Magento将仍然不能使用。

4.在新的地方重新安装MAGENTO,再将app和skin文件全部覆盖去,访问新的地方的phpmyadmin,点击导入,将上面的那个文件选择进去,如果太大,压缩为ZIP格式,点击执行。

5.完成之后将新的magento文件夹下面var/ session,和var/cache下面的缓存文件全部清空。

到此,Magento数据转移全部完成,换服务器或主机转移magento是件比较麻烦的事情,100magento希望这篇文章可以减少正在转移magento数据的人的烦恼与痛苦。

 

文章转自:magento开发

 

 

原创粉丝点击